The Local Area

From your hotel you can get to the major attractions such as the magnificent Royal Palace, the official residence of the Spanish Royal Family. While they don’t actually reside at the palace, it is used for special events and functions. The exterior is alive with statues of saints and kings and the interior is beautiful, be sure to have a look at the manicured gardens before you leave.

Plaza Mayor is a major tourist attraction and an important piece of Madrid’s history. This square has seen games, bull fights and markets. Today it stands proud surrounded by beautiful buildings, cobblestoned square and tables dotted around where you can sit and relax and enjoy the beauty of the area.

Centre de Art Reina Sofia is an art museum with a collection of Spanish art from the twentieth century. Here you will find beautiful paintings by Picasso. Stop in at the library where you will find over one hundred thousand books about art.

Head to Parque de Buen Retiro, one of the largest parks in Spain with ponds, rose gardens, statues, monuments and art galleries. The marble statues sit in landscaped gardens. A beautiful tranquil area away from the bustle of the city centre where you can enjoy a leisurely walk and soak up the picturesque scenery.

If you love art then be sure to stop in at the Prado Museum. The main Spanish national art museum with the finest European art collection in the world. This museum is home to 7,600 paintings, there are also 1,000 sculptures for you to see, 4,800 prints and 8,200 drawings including work by some of Spain’s finest artists including Francisco de Goya and Velazquez.
